Given two alternatives A and B, where B is the higher investment cost alternative. The incremental investment (B-A) cash flow is calculated, and the Fisherian rate is seen to be 9.05%. The MARR rate is set at 6%. The alternatives are mutually exclusive. This analysis suggests:
Group of answer choices
Alternative B is preferred.
Alternative A is preferred.
Neither A nor B is preferred.
B dominates A for all interest rates >0.
A dominates B for all interest rates >0
